A sample of gas of unknown pressure occupies 0.766 L at a temperature of 298 K. The same sample of gas is then tested under known conditions and has a pressure of 32.6 kPa and occupies 0.644 L at 303 K. What was the original pressure of the gas

Answers

Answer 1

Answer:

26.96 kPa

Explanation:

Applying,

PV/T = P'V'/T'............... Equation 1

Where P = Initial pressure, V = Initial volume, T = Initial temperature, P' = Final pressure, V' = Final volume, T' = Final temperature.

make P the subject of the equation

P = P'V'T/VT'.............. Equation 2

From the question,

Given: V = 0.766 L, T = 298 K, P' = 32.6 kPa, V' = 0.644 L, T' = 303 K

Substitute these values into equation 2

P = (32.6×0.644×298)/(0.766×303)

P = 26.96 kPa

When aqueous solutions of AgNO3 and MgCl2 are mixed, a precipitate forms. What is the correct formula for the precipitate

Answers

Answer:

AgCl

Explanation:

The reaction that takes place is:

2AgNO₃ (aq) + MgCl₂ (aq) → Mg(NO₃) (aq) + 2AgCl (s)

The precipitate (meaning a solid substance) formed is silver chloride, AgCl.

All salts formed with silver and a halogen (F, Cl, Br, I) are insoluble in water, meaning that when working with aqueous solutions they will be precipitates.

Where does the 2.303 value come from?

Answers

Answer:

2.303 is a conversion factor from natural log to log10.Log is commonly represented in base-10 whereas natural log or Ln is represented in base e. Now e has a value of 2.71828. So e raised to the power of 2.303 equals 10 ie 2.71828 raised to the power of 2.303 equals 10 and hence ln 10 equals 2.303 and so we multiply 2.303 to convert ln to log.

Gasoline and motor oil are chemically similar. They are both mixtures of nonpolar hydrocarbons
containing carbon and hydrogen atoms. However, motor oil is much more viscous than gasoline. Which
substance probably has the higher average molar mass?

Answers

Answer:

motor oil

Explanation:

According to Oxford dictionary, viscosity refers to ''a quantity expressing the magnitude of internal friction in a fluid, as measured by the force per unit area resisting uniform flow.''

The higher the molecular weight of a substance, the greater its viscosity. This is because, the long chains in the viscous substance become entangled thereby increasing the internal friction in the liquid.

Motor oil is a heavier hydrocarbon than gasoline hence it is more viscous than gasoline.

The pH of the ocean is 8.1. What is the concentration of hydronium ions?

Answers

Answer:

7.9 × 10⁻⁹ M

Explanation:

Step 1: Given data

pH of the ocean: 8.1

Step 2: Calculate the concentration of hydronium ions

We will use the definition of pH.

pH = -log [H⁺] = -log [H₃O⁺]

[H₃O⁺] = [H⁺] = antilog -pH

[H₃O⁺] = antilog -8.1 = 7.9 × 10⁻⁹ M

Since [H₃O⁺] < 10⁻⁷ M, the solution is basic.

Which example shows a double replacement reaction?

Answers

Answer:

KCl + AgNO₃ —> AgCl + KNO₃

Explanation:

To answer the question correctly, we must understand the definition of a double displacement reaction.

A double displacement reaction is a reaction in which the ions of the two reacting compounds exchange to form new compounds different from the two reacting compounds. Example is given below:

XY + AB —> XB + AY

Considering the options given in the question above, only the equation:

KCl + AgNO₃ —> AgCl + KNO₃

Satisfy the definition of a double displacement reaction.

g Draw the most stable chair conformation for each of the following compounds (a) Cis-1-ethyl-2-methyl cyclohexane (b) Trans-1-ethyl-2-methyl cyclohexane (c) Which one is more stable, a or b

Answers

Answer:

See explanation

Explanation:

Image 1 is the chair conformation of trans-1-ethyl-2-methyl cyclohexane while image 2 is the chair conformation of Cis-1-ethyl-2-methyl cyclohexane.

Now let us look at the two structures closely. In the chair conformation, the more stable structure is the structure that has the bulky groups placed in the equatorial position.

Clearly, in trans-1-ethyl-2-methylcyclohexane, the ethyl and methyl groups are found to be in equatorial positions. Hence, trans-1-ethyl-2-methylcyclohexane is more stable in the chair conformation than cis-1-ethyl-2-methyl cyclohexane which has its methyl and ethyl groups in axial position.

What is the pH of a 0.086 M HCl solution?

Answers

Answer: pH = 1.066

Explanation: HCl is strong acid and it protolyzes totally:

HCl + H2O  ⇒ H3O+ + Cl-

Concentrations are same:  [H3O+] = c(HCl)

pH = - log[H3O+] = - log(0.086) = 1.0655

An aqueous salt solution is 15.0% mass sodium chloride. How many grams of salt are in 250.0 grams of this solution? Use correct
significant figures.

Answers

Answer:

37.5 g NaCl

Explanation:

Step 1: Given data

Concentration of NaCl: 15.0% m/mMass of the solution: 250.0 g

Step 2: Calculate how many grams of NaCl are in 250.0 g of solution

The concentration of NaCl is 15.0% by mass, that is, there are 15.0 g of NaCl every 100 g of solution.

250.0 g Solution × 15.0 g NaCl/100 g Solution = 37.5 g NaCl
